Daylight Savings Time changes

As you are probably aware of by now, the daylight savings time rules are changing this year. RipIt4Me

RipIt4Me is a freeware utility that helps you backup your copy protected DVDs. Recently released DVDs are now very often equipped with stronger copy protections – such as ARccOSâ„¢ and RipGuard DVD.
